Machine Learning and Neural Networks (CM3015)

This module provides a broad view of machine learning and neural networks. You will learn how to solve common machine learning problems such as regression, classification, clustering, matrix completion and pattern recognition. You will learn about neural networks and how they can be trained and optimised, including an exploration of deep neural networks. You will learn about machine learning and neural network software libraries that allow you to develop machine learning systems rapidly, and you will learn how to verify and evaluate the results.

Topics covered

  • Regression and classification
  • Features and distances
  • Supervised clustering
  • Evaluation: accuracy, precision, recall and cross validation
  • Dimensional reduction: principal component analysis
  • Matrix completion
  • Unsupervised clustering
  • Multi-Layer Perceptrons and back progagation
  • Network optimisers
  • Deep and recurrent networks

Assessment

Coursework only (Type II).
